Tender Title: Lead Anode Details as per Drg. No. GCF/20/SK-786/1 for Hard Chrom Plating
Tender Reference Number: 38b00312
Issuing Authority:
Department of Defence Production, Ministry of Defence
The Lead Anode Details tender aims to procure specialized components required for the hard chromium plating process. This procurement is critical for ensuring quality production standards in defense equipment and related applications. The target deliverables, as per the specifications outlined in the designated drawings (GCF/20/SK-786/1), require suppliers to meet specific technical and quality benchmarks.

The eligibility requirements include being a registered entity with a proven track record in supplying defense-related products. Bidders must demonstrate experience in manufacturing or supplying items similar to those requested and must comply with outlined quality standards.
To participate in defense tenders, vendors need to submit certifications that validate their compliance with technical specifications and quality standards. These may include industry-standard certifications, product safety certificates, and any other relevant documentation that confirms the integrity of the offered products.
Interested bidders can begin the registration process by accessing the relevant government procurement portal. They must complete the registration form, submit necessary credentials, and ensure their profile is activated to receive notifications and documents related to the tender.
All submissions must adhere to the stipulated document formats as detailed in the tender guidelines. Commonly accepted formats often include PDF, DOC, or other electronic formats as specified, ensuring that all documents are clear and legible.
Payment terms are typically outlined in the tender document, specifying conditions for payment upon successful delivery. Additionally, a performance security is often required to ensure contract fulfillment; this is usually a percentage of the contract value, held until successful completion of the project, thereby safeguarding the interests of the buyer.
